Output d6039b3f0ef5f8bc43e803f8b4fa15a10c62613988328447c22f4c91bfe5ec12:2

value
138765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b6023de88f59bf16d06b634e9ad823cf9ebc6e OP_EQUAL
address
32DDLh9h2qGb9J3cH9B5p4y843xYBy1c6j
transaction
d6039b3f0ef5f8bc43e803f8b4fa15a10c62613988328447c22f4c91bfe5ec12
spent
true